Resultados de la búsqueda a petición "stack"

1 la respuesta

Hacking Challenge: localizar la vulnerabilidad en el código

Mi amigo completó recientemente un desafío de piratería y me lo envió (binario y fuente). Quería preguntar aquí antes de pedirle consejos, ya que quiero hacerlo yo mismo :) Lo he estado pasando pero estoy luchando por encontrar la ...

1 la respuesta

gcc, montaje en línea: ¿falta pushad / popad?

Cualquier forma de evitar tener que copiar y pegarpushad/popad cuerpo de instrucciones en mi código? Porque gcc (banderas actuales:-Wall -m32) se queja de que __asm__("pushad;");Error: no hay tal instrucción: `pushad ' __asm__("popad;");Error: ...

1 la respuesta

¿Puedes obtener una lista de variables en la pila en C #?

Todo, ¿me pregunto si es posible en .NET / C # obtener una lista de variables en la pila y sus valores? Estoy creando un controlador de excepciones para mi aplicación y más allá de un seguimiento de pila estándar. También me gustaría ver los ...

1 la respuesta

Durante una interrupción de software x86, ¿cuándo se realiza exactamente un cambio de contexto?

Pregunto esto porque estoy tratando de implementar interrupciones en mi kernel de juguete. Entonces, sé que cuando ocurre una interrupción, la CPU empuja varios bits de información a la pila. Sin embargo, en todas partes que busco en línea se ...

1 la respuesta

¿Por qué gcc genera una dirección de devolución adicional?

Actualmente estoy aprendiendo los conceptos básicos de ensamblaje y encontré algo extraño al mirar las instrucciones generadas por gcc (6.1.1). Aquí está la fuente: #include <stdio.h> int foo(int x, int y){ return x*y; } int main(){ int a = ...

1 la respuesta

¿Cómo invierto una pila usando otra pila en java [cerrado]

Hola, estoy tratando de revertir una pila (una que yo mismo codifiqué) usando otra pila vacía. Por alguna razón no funciona correctamente. Puede alguien ayudarme con esto ? public static void main(String[] args) { Stack stack1 = new Stack(); ...

1 la respuesta

prueba de carga: la liberación provoca un desbordamiento de la pila. ¿Por qué el banco de carga no?

Al intentar escribir un algoritmo DSP optimizado, me preguntaba acerca de la velocidad relativa entre la asignación de la pila y la asignación del montón, y los límites de tamaño de las matrices asignadas a la pila. Me doy cuenta de que hay un ...

1 la respuesta

Matriz de tamaño variable en la pila [duplicado]

Esta pregunta ya tiene una respuesta aquí: g ++ matriz de tamaño variable sin advertencia? [/questions/17899274/g-variable-size-array-no-warning] 1 respuestaEntiendo que en C y C ++, creamos estructuras de datos cuyo tamaño se conoce en tiempo ...

1 la respuesta

VBA System.Collections.Queue

Acabo de descubriraquí [http://analystcave.com/excel-vba-dictionary-arrays-and-other-data-structures/#The_VBA_Queue] el 'incorporado'Stacks yQueues disponible de VBA. Por la forma en que está escrito, no puedo ver las propiedades y métodos ...

1 la respuesta

¿Hay alguna forma de examinar las variables de la pila en tiempo de ejecución en C #?

¿Hay alguna forma de volcar el contenido de la pila en tiempo de ejecución? Estoy interesado en la información de las funciones principales (nombre, parámetros, línea) que sé que puedo obtener con las clases StackTrace y StackFrame. Sin ...